A power standard is a benchmark for a particular level of performance or success. There are several synonyms for this term, including criterion, benchmark, yardstick, gauge, measure, norm, parameter, level, and bar. These words refer to a particular level of expectation or achievement and provide a way to measure progress or evaluate success. Each of these synonyms carries slightly different connotations, but all refer to a standard that is used to determine whether a certain level of performance has been achieved. Whether in business, education, or personal development, having a clear power standard can help to set goals, motivate individuals, and assess progress towards achieving success.
